Stove fans really maximise the heat given out by stoves, helping it to project further out and around the space. Stove fans are designed to sit on top of the stove and circulate the warm air, distributing it evenly around the space.What's more, because they are powered by the heat generated by the stove, they require no power source or batteries. Three, using a convection fan for wood stove comes with the additional benefit of keeping your home warm for long. The fans have inbuilt self-regulating mechanisms to control their operations. When the temperatures rise to a given level, normally about 212 degrees Fahrenheit, the motor of the fan automatically starts to run.

Most stove fans contain a thermoelectric module that functions as the fan’s generator. Thermoelectricityis produced when semiconductors inside the fan’s motor are at different temperaturesleading to a small generation of electricity. The surface temperature of your stove heats up, prompting it to draw cooler air and propel the fan. Primarily, a wood stove fan successfully drives the conversion of heat energy from your wood stove to kinetic energy that drives its blades.
